How To Choose a Foundation Repair Company

Conduct research before starting your foundation repair project in order to find the most qualified foundation repair provider. Here are the main factors you should consider.

Experience

We suggest hiring a local foundation repair provider with a proven reputation for fixing various foundation issues. These companies should have expertise in the latest materials and techniques. Ask how many years a provider has served your area.

Reputation

Looking through online reviews, checking the Better Business Bureau, and requesting local references helps verify that a company routinely provides quality work and great customer service. Pay attention if you see numerous complaints about poor service or faulty repairs.

Licensing and Insurance

Choose a provider that has valid licenses, bonds, and insurance policies for liability and workers' compensation. New York does not have state-level licensing requirements for general contractors, but there may be regulations at the city or county level, so make sure that you check with your local government. You can confirm that a company holds a valid New York business license on this website. Contractors may have to meet additional requirements to do certain work with concrete.

Warranties

Pick a company that offers transferable warranties for a minimum of a decade and, if possible, lifetime guarantees to fully back its work. This displays faith that their repairs will be high-quality and long-lasting and provides protection if problems come up later.

Questions To Ask Foundation Repair Companies

During your assessment of potential foundation repair companies, make sure to ask in-depth questions such as:

  • What financing options do you offer? Providers often offer payment plans for larger foundation repairs.
  • What exact repair method would you recommend for my specific situation and why? Your provider may consider options such as carbon fiber, steel piers, and wall anchors. By asking, you can get an idea of what solutions a company offers and compare between providers.
  • What type of warranties are provided? Trustworthy providers often offer warranties of at least 10 years on materials and labor.
  • What foundation flaws did you find during inspection that could be causing the issue? The response should have easy-to-understand explanations and solutions. If a provider offers an unclear answer, it may be trying to bill you for unneeded work.
  • Can you provide a project scope and cost estimate in writing? Make sure to get quotes in writing to protect yourself from unexpected costs.
  • How long will the repairs realistically take to complete? Look for companies that provide reasonable estimates.

Taking time to vet foundation repair companies will help you identify the right one for you. Providers that can thoroughly answer these questions will likely provide high-quality, durable repairs. Swiftly fixing foundation issues helps prevent future structural damage.

Frequently Asked Questions About Foundation Repair in Buffalo, NY

There are certain signs that your foundation is in need of repair. These might include:

  • Visible crumbling or cracking of your foundation
  • Uneven basement or ground-level floors
  • Bowing, buckling, or cracked walls
  • Window frames or door frames that are skewed or tight
  • Cracks in your basement floor
  • Cracks in your driveway

On average, Buffalo homeowners pay roughly $2,991 for foundation repair, although the total cost will change based on several factors. The easiest way to estimate the cost of your specific job is to ask for quotes from a handful of local foundation repair companies. The amount you pay for a job will be affected by things like the size of your house and type of repair(s) needed.

Types of foundation repair include leak repair, crack repair, stabilization, underpinning, and waterproofing.

For both leak repair and crack repair, a technician will come to your home, complete an inspection, and use various repair techniques to remedy leaks or cracks. The amount you spend can vary greatly depending on the size and cause of the issue.

Stabilization reinforces bowing walls by inserting carbon fiber or steel strips. The cost will depend on the material used and how many strips are required. The cost of underpinning also varies. This process, sometimes referred to as piering or leveling, involves underpinning your foundation with concrete piers to level it; the cost will be based on how many piers are used.

If you're looking to waterproof your foundation or basement, we recommend talking to a waterproofing specialist. This process might include indoor waterproofing, outdoor waterproofing, or both.

When caring for your foundation, you should make sure that it gets the right amount of moisture. Avoid letting the soil around your Buffalo house become too wet or too dry – make changes to your gutter system to route water away, or water your foundation if it starts to get too dry. Also make sure that you quickly identify and repair any leaking gutters or pipes.

If you have any concerns about your foundation, you can contact a structural engineer for an evaluation. This will run you a few hundred dollars, but the engineer's consultation can net you a list of things to be aware of as well as steps you can take to further protect your foundation. Lastly, if you're building a new home, be sure that you have a soil report done. This can provide information about how well the soil on your property will be able to support a foundation, and can highlight potential future problems.

Foundation repair usually requires a permit, but obtaining one isn't your responsibility. Your foundation repair provider should put together the permit and all other documents required in Buffalo, and should be able to explain the process and/or provide the documents before starting work.

You may not want to spend money hiring someone for a seemingly small foundation repair. However, it's always in your best interest to consult a professional. This way, you can avoid potential future issues that could be even more expensive. It may be possible to repair small hairline cracks on your own, but it's always in your best interest to get an expert opinion first.

We recommend that you do not put off a foundation repair project. A single issue may have an underlying cause that could potentially result in future problems, and it's best to get ahead of the issue as soon as possible. A minor problem now could turn into a large and expensive one in the future if left untreated.
